Although I've now upgraded the level generator to handle more than 1 biscuit at a time, the maximum it seems to be able to make levels with is 2.
After that, biscuits keep falling off the level, and the levels aren't completable.
So, one or two biscuits at a time, but the levels are still kinda samey.

Tonight I worked on the level generator for the Biscuit Puzzler, and it seems to work reasonably well.
The main problem now, is that with one biscuit in a grid of 5x5, the gameplay's more than a little repetitive.
I'm going to have to see if I can come up with something a little more interesting to keep the game alive.
As it stands, though, there's some fiendishly difficult puzzles coming out of the generator, and that's good to see

According to what I've read online, I need to convert the socket to a non-blocking socket, then try to connect, and THEN (after trying to connect?!) tell it to set the timeout to a low number.

Today during testing, I hit a rather nasty issue with the framework.
When coding the Online Scoreboard component, I added a 5 second timeout to the code.
Unfortunately, as well as that works "in theory", the timeout is completely ignored during the "connect" part of the script.
